The cash portion of the purchase price will be financed using available funds in Semcon. In addition, earn-outs, paid in cash, may amount to a maximum of SEK 39 million if the operating profit exceeds certain benchmark levels during 2021-2023. The purchase price for 100 per cent of the shares, on a cash and debt-free basis, initially amounts to SEK 61 million, of which SEK 56 million will be paid in cash and SEK 5 million will be paid in the form of 42,585 shares in Semcon 1). In 2020, sales amounted to SEK 105 million and operating profit to SEK 14 million, yielding an operating margin of 13 per cent. Squeed, which will join Semcon’s Engineering & Digital Services business area, has 95 employees and strengthens Semcon’s presence mainly in Göteborg and Stockholm, but also in Oslo. Meta supports all popular audio formats such as: mp3, mp4, m4a, aiff, wav, flac, ogg, oga, opus, spx, and writes metadata formats ID3 (v1, v2.3, v2.4), MP4, Vorbis, INFO and APE Tags.
